KERN & SOHN GmbH is expanding its range of microscopes with the KERN OBN 142 fluorescence microscope with integrated LED fluorescence unit. It is aimed at professionals in research, diagnostics and teaching. Based on the proven OBN-14 series, it offers a high-quality infinity optics system and a trinocular eyepiece tube. Five planachromatic lenses with magnifications from 4x to 100x and a stable angle table with coaxial coarse and fine focusing knob enable precise sample analysis in the laboratory.
The professional Köhler illumination unit with a centreable 1.25 ABBE condenser ensures high-contrast illumination in transmitted light. The light source is a 3 W LED transmitted illumination unit. There is a separate 5 W LED incident illumination unit for fluorescence applications.
The LED fluorescence unit has a filter wheel that can be equipped with up to six standard filters for UV, V, B and G. It is suitable for immunofluorescence, nucleic acid staining and FISH analyses, among other things. Compared to mercury-vapour lamps, LEDs offer many advantages: longer service life, immediate operational readiness, lower heat generation and lower energy consumption. LEDs contain no mercury, which makes them easier to handle and dispose of, and they provide constant light intensity without flickering.

The modular design enables the integration of accessories such as darkfield condensers, phase-contrast units or polarisation modules. A centring lens, a protective dust cover, eye cups as well as multi-lingual user instructions are included with the delivery. A C-mount adapter is required to connect a camera.
The microscope is also available as a complete digital solution with a camera and adapter. The KERN ODC 861 fluorescence camera has a light-sensitive Sony CMOS colour sensor and integrated Peltier cooling. The KERN OXM 902 software enables image acquisition, management and analysis on a PC.
